Understanding Therapeutic Ultrasound: More Than Just an Image
When most people hear the word "ultrasound," they think of the diagnostic imaging used during pregnancy or to view internal organs. However, therapeutic ultrasound is fundamentally different. While both use sound waves, their purpose and function are worlds apart.
Therapeutic ultrasound is the application of high-frequency sound waves (typically 1 to 3 MHz) to stimulate and treat tissues deep beneath the skin's surface. Unlike its diagnostic counterpart, which creates a picture, therapeutic ultrasound is designed to produce a specific physiological effect to promote healing. It is a cornerstone of modern physiotherapy, valued for its ability to target specific muscles, tendons, ligaments, and joints. When administered by a qualified physiotherapist, it is a completely painless and safe procedure, making it an essential tool in our arsenal for effective soft tissue injury treatment.
How Ultrasound Therapy Works to Reduce Inflammation
The magic of therapeutic ultrasound lies in its ability to interact with your body’s tissues through two primary mechanisms: thermal (heating) and non-thermal (mechanical) effects. Your physiotherapist will choose the appropriate setting based on your specific condition—whether your inflammation is acute (recent) or chronic (long-standing).
Thermal Effects (Deep Heating)
When the ultrasound machine is set to a continuous mode, the sound waves create vibrations in the tissue molecules, generating a gentle, deep heat. This is not like a surface-level heating pad; it penetrates up to 5 cm deep. This deep heat is incredibly beneficial for chronic inflammation and stiffness. It works by:
- Increasing Blood Flow: The warmth causes blood vessels to dilate, significantly improving circulation to the targeted area.
- Delivering Nutrients: This enhanced blood flow brings a fresh supply of oxygen and essential nutrients that are vital for repair.
- Removing Waste: It simultaneously helps flush out metabolic by-products and inflammatory waste, which are often the culprits behind persistent pain.
The result is reduced chronic inflammation, effective ultrasound for pain relief, and improved flexibility of tight muscles and connective tissues.
Non-Thermal Effects (Cellular Stimulation)
For acute injuries where heat might be undesirable (like a fresh ankle sprain), the ultrasound is used in a pulsed mode. This creates mechanical effects without a significant increase in temperature. The key processes are:
- Cavitation: The sound waves cause microscopic gas bubbles present in your bodily fluids to expand and contract. This stable, controlled movement is beneficial.
- Acoustic Streaming: This process creates a gentle swirling of fluid around cells.
This microscopic activity acts like a deep-tissue micromassage at the cellular level. It stimulates the cell membranes, increasing their permeability and accelerating crucial healing processes like protein synthesis and cellular repair. This is especially effective for reducing swelling (edema) and promoting tissue regeneration in the initial stages of an injury.
The Key Benefits of Choosing Ultrasound for Pain and Inflammation
Integrating therapeutic ultrasound into a comprehensive physiotherapy plan offers a multitude of tangible benefits that help you recover faster and more effectively.
- Accelerated Tissue Healing: By stimulating cellular activity, it speeds up the natural inflammatory and repair phases of healing.
- Effective Pain Relief: The therapy helps to block pain transmission in nerve fibres and reduces the pressure caused by swelling.
- Reduced Inflammation and Swelling: It improves lymphatic drainage and circulation to carry away excess fluid from the injured area.
- Increased Blood Flow: Delivers the oxygen and nutrients that damaged tissues are starved for.
- Improved Mobility and Range of Motion: The deep heat can help break down scar tissue adhesions and improve the extensibility of collagen in tendons and ligaments.
- Non-Invasive and Drug-Free: It provides powerful relief without the need for injections or long-term medication, making it an excellent complement to any recovery plan.

- Assessment: Your physiotherapist will first assess the area to confirm that ultrasound is the right treatment for your current condition.
- Preparation: A special water-based gel will be applied to your skin over the target area. This gel helps eliminate any air pockets and ensures the sound waves are transmitted efficiently into your tissues.
- Application: The therapist will then take a small, handheld device called a transducer head (or wand) and move it continuously in slow, small circles over the treatment area.
- Sensation: The procedure is entirely painless. Most patients feel nothing at all, while some may experience a very mild, pleasant warmth.
- Duration: A typical ultrasound treatment is brief, usually lasting between 5 to 10 minutes for each specific area being treated.
